One of the primary safety considerations is the physical space of the dance floor. It is crucial to make sure that the space is sufficiently sized enough to hold the anticipated number of guests. A packed dance floor can result to incidents, such as falls or crashes. Planners should also check the flooring type to confirm it is appropriate for dancing. Even surfaces, such as wood or laminate, are preferred, while rug can pose slipping hazards. Additionally, keeping the dance area free of obstacles, such as chairs or furniture, will help avoid injuries and allow for a more enjoyable experience.



Lighting plays a significant role in establishing a secure dance floor setting. Proper lighting not only establishes the mood for the occasion but also helps guests navigate the space safely. Low lighting can make it difficult for dancers to perceive their surroundings, raising the risk of incidents. Therefore, organizers should use a mix of ambient and directed lighting to illuminate the dance floor sufficiently. Emergency indicators should also be easily visible, and planners should ensure that the illumination is adjustable to suit different types of music and dance genres.

Another important aspect of security on the dance floor is crowd management. Event staff should be dance floor rental for quinceaneras trained to oversee the dance area and make sure that guests are behaving properly. This includes addressing any instances of overcrowding or unacceptable behavior that could result to conflicts. Additionally, having a specific area for guests to take breaks can help minimize fatigue and prevent accidents. Providing water dispensers nearby can also promote hydration, which is essential for keeping energy levels during the dance.



Finally, it is essential to share safety protocols to all attendees. Before the event begins, planners should notify guests about the rules and expectations for the dance floor. This can include notices to be mindful of their surroundings, honor personal space, and avoid excessive drinking consumption. Providing clear instructions can help foster a culture of security and responsibility among guests. By cultivating an atmosphere where everyone is conscious of safety measures, event planners can guarantee that the dance floor remains a fun and secure space for all attendees.
